  • A bed alarm for seniors is a device that alerts a caregiver when the senior is getting out of bed. There are three types of bed alarms: Bed alarm pads, motion sensors, and pull cord alarms. A bed alarm pad is placed under the patient, and it can sense as soon as the amount of weight on top of it is reduced.

One way to prevent the elderly from falling out of bed is to use a bed alarm. Basically, what a bed alarm does is alert you when your parent or spouse attempts to exit their bed. Normally, rolling is ignored by the bed alarm pad, but when they lift their weight off, the bed monitor will be triggered and the bed sensor alarm will sound.

What is a bed alarm?

A bed sensor alarm is a personal bed alarm that allows a caregiver to monitor the activity of a patient or loved one in bed . Bed alarms , essentially, will alert the unit when pressure is removed from the sensor.

Are Bed alarms illegal?

According to CMS, a revision to the State Operations Manual will now classify bed and chair alarms , or any position change alarms which make an audible noise near the resident as a restraint. Restraints can only be used when deemed medically necessary and even then, must be continuously reevaluated for use.

Do bed and chair alarms prevent falls?

About 25% of falls in hospitalized patients result in injury, and 2% result in fractures (4). Bed alarm systems (for example, bed or chair alarms ) could therefore reduce falls by alerting personnel when at-risk patients attempt to leave a bed or chair without assistance.

Do Bed alarms prevent falls in nursing homes?

Alarms are most impactful in reducing falls for residents with cognitive impairments [7,11,12,15,17,18,19,21,22,23,24,28,32,33,34,35]. Alarms also reduce the burden of care placed upon staff [15,17]. Staff of nursing facilities especially have a favorable view of bed and chair alarms [15,17].

Are Bed alarms effective?

Bed exit alarms warn caregivers when patients leave or attempt to leave their beds . The Joint Commission on Accreditation of Healthcare Organizations (JCAHO) cites bed exit alarms as both part of effective risk reduction strategies and as one of the root causes of problems when they malfunction or are misused.

Can nursing homes use bed rails?

Bedrails are often standard on nursing home beds — which are essentially hospital beds that have been adapted for use in the nursing home . Many die from suffocation because the bed rail has restricted their breathing. According to the Consumer Product Safety Commission and the US FDA, bed rails can be dangerous.

Do nursing home patients have the right to fall?

All nursing homes are legally required to assess residents for fall risks. Performing a fall risk assessment should be done when designing a resident’s care plan to promote health and safety. Serious falls may occur if the staff leaves a high-risk resident unattended for just a few minutes.

Do alarm devices reduce falls in the elderly population?

Analysis of the data indicated that there was a total of 94 falls in the facility that used the bed/body alarms , and a total of 70 falls in the facility that did not use the bed/body alarms . The analysis of data suggested that the use of bed/body alarms did not reduce falls within the elderly population .

How do you set a bed alarm?

In order to activate the alarm , the patient has to first get in the bed and then you have to push the button that activates it. Every bed is different so it’s hard to say what the button will look like but most will have an indicator light or make a beeping sound so you know it is set .
